ATLANTA — Atlanta R&B group TLC has developed a musical about their colorful career that will open in the District of Columbia in 2026.
“CrazySexyCool — The Musical” will debut at Arena Stage in June 2026 and run for eight weeks.
TLC’s story has been told before, including two VH1 “Behind the Music” specials, a scripted VH1 movie in 2013 and 2023 documentary “TLC Forever.” The innovative Grammy-winning group has experienced no shortage of drama, including financial problems, internal creative tensions and the 2002 death of Lisa “Left Eye” Lopes. The other two members, Rozonda “Chilli” Thomas and Tionne “T-Boz” Watkins, still tour, recording their most recent album in 2017.
We have so many stories to tell,” Thomas said at the time. “We didn’t tell it all in our biopic we did with VH1. A lot of good stuff. It’s gonna be very emotional but a good ride.”
